✦ Synopsis


This paper presents the results of an analysis and measurements performed on an earth-air tunnel system for cooling and heating buildings. The experiments were performed all year around on a large, already built tunnel, the cooling~heating performance of which was also studied. The measurements were verified by a simple theory. The cooling capacity of the tunnel was found to be considerably greater than its heating capacity.
